Output 25d8dbc878497651a68b074c75516c86aff4064a82f754af83d66e78e53048a1:89

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 808c3063b84c79b3abc3bf5d055d2befbf1ed15ea6c1ace27292b821a85a3fb9
address
bc1pszxrqcacf3um827rhaws2hfta7l3a5275mq6ecnjj2uzr2z687usy7nd43
transaction
25d8dbc878497651a68b074c75516c86aff4064a82f754af83d66e78e53048a1
spent
true